The game that I've been running the last year or so is in a newly created world (as in, newly created by the gods) and is trying to be the world of myths, where the characters are heroes who will have grand bardic tales written about them in the generations to come. I don't know about you, but "Kage, the honourable sword saint, returned the poor widow's only son from the goblin slavers, and in return she gave him her widow's shawl, because she had nothing, and he had restored her hope by restoring her son" (the shawl allows the character to instill hope in his allies, giving them bonuses to morale and combat) is far more exciting than, "Fighter X killed the medusa with his +2 sword, which he bought from the local Magi-Mart on special."
Having said that, there are people who sell magic in one part of my world (because it is a place run by merchants, so everything is for sale) - but thanks to this thread, I will make sure that all those who trade in magic items will now be evil
